Methods for causal attribution in model predictions to identify spurious correlations in datasets.
This evergreen guide explores systematic approaches to attributing causality in machine learning predictions, emphasizing methods, pitfalls, and practical steps to reveal spurious correlations masking genuine signals in data.
Published August 08, 2025
Facebook X Reddit Pinterest Email
In modern machine learning practice, causality sits at the intersection of theory and application, guiding how models interpret associations and how users interpret outputs. Causal attribution seeks to determine which input features truly drive predictions, rather than merely co-occurring with outcomes. This distinction matters for robustness, fairness, and generalization across domains. Practitioners often confront data that reflect incidental patterns, confounding variables, or sampling biases. The challenge is to separate genuine cause from correlation, ensuring that deployed models respond to underlying mechanisms rather than artifacts of the training set. Achieving this separation involves careful experimental design, rigorous validation, and transparent reporting.
A practical starting point is to frame the problem with explicit causal questions and testable hypotheses. Analysts can construct directed graphs that encode assumed relationships among variables, then examine how interventions might shift predictions. This approach clarifies which features should influence decisions and helps reveal where model behavior diverges from domain knowledge. In parallel, statistical methods such as counterfactual simulations and permutation tests provide observable criteria to assess sensitivity. By systematically perturbing inputs and observing changes in outputs, teams gain insight into causal leverage rather than mere statistical association. The result is a clearer map of drivers behind predictions and a more trustworthy model.
Distinguishing correlation from causation through targeted diagnostics
To advance causal attribution, practitioners increasingly rely on counterfactual analysis, where hypothetical changes to inputs reveal how outcomes would differ under alternate realities. This technique helps identify whether a feature’s influence is direct or mediated through another variable. It is particularly powerful when combined with causal diagrams that lay out assumptions about cause-and-effect paths. Yet counterfactual reasoning depends on plausible, testable assumptions and well-specified models. Without careful design, interventions may yield misleading conclusions, especially in high-dimensional spaces where many features interact. The key is to anchor analyses in domain expertise and transparent model specifications.
ADVERTISEMENT
ADVERTISEMENT
Another essential method is randomized experimentation embedded within data generation or simulation environments. Randomization disrupts spurious correlations by breaking systematic links between features, enabling clearer attribution of effects to deliberate changes. In practice, this might involve synthetic data experiments, controlled feature perturbations, or ablation studies that systematically remove components of the input. While not always feasible in real-world settings, simulated environments provide a sandbox to verify causal claims before deployment. When feasible, randomized approaches substantially strengthen confidence in the attribution results and offer reproducible evidence.
Tools for robust causal attribution across datasets and models
Model-agnostic diagnostics offer a suite of checks that complement causal graphs and experiments. Techniques such as feature importance, SHAP values, and partial dependence plots can highlight influential inputs, yet they must be interpreted cautiously. High importance alone does not imply causality; a feature may proxy for an unobserved cause or reflect data leakage. Responsible analysis pairs these diagnostics with interventions and domain-informed expectations. By triangulating signals from multiple methods, analysts build a coherent narrative about what drives predictions and what remains an artifact of data structure.
ADVERTISEMENT
ADVERTISEMENT
Leveraging techniques like invariant prediction and causal discovery strengthens attribution. Invariant prediction seeks features whose predictive relationship remains stable across diverse environments, suggesting a causal link less susceptible to spurious shifts. Causal discovery methods attempt to infer directional relationships from observational data, though they rely on strong assumptions and careful validation. Combined, these approaches encourage models that generalize beyond the training context and resist shortcuts created by dataset peculiarities. The overall objective is to separate robust causal signals from brittle correlations.
Practical steps to identify spurious correlations and fix them
Transfer learning and cross-domain evaluation provide practical tests for attribution validity. If a feature’s impact persists when the model is applied to new but related tasks, that persistence supports a causal interpretation. Conversely, dramatic shifts in behavior can reveal overfitting to dataset idiosyncrasies. Evaluations should span multiple domains, data generations, and sampling schemes to avoid hidden biases. This cross-checking process yields better confidence that the model’s logic aligns with real-world mechanisms rather than dataset artefacts. It also informs data collection priorities by spotlighting essential variables.
Causal sensitivity analysis offers a structured framework to quantify how inputs influence outputs under varied conditions. By exploring a spectrum of plausible data-generating processes, analysts measure the stability of predictions. Such analyses illuminate how assumptions shape conclusions and where uncertainties are concentrated. Documentation of these conditions helps stakeholders understand when decisions based on the model are reliable and when caution is warranted. Emphasizing transparency in these analyses reinforces trust and accountability in automated decision systems.
ADVERTISEMENT
ADVERTISEMENT
Synthesis: integrating methods for durable, reliable models
The first practical step is to audit data collection pipelines for leakage, label noise, and sampling bias. Understanding how data were gathered helps reveal potential channels through which spurious correlations enter models. This audit should be paired with a plan for data augmentation and cleaning to minimize artifacts. Clear documentation of data provenance, feature engineering choices, and modeling assumptions supports reproducibility and future scrutiny. With a solid data foundation, attribution efforts can proceed with greater precision and less risk of confounding factors skewing results.
A second step involves designing intervention experiments and validating causal claims under realistic conditions. When feasible, implement controlled perturbations, synthetic data tests, or environment-aware evaluations to observe how predictions respond to deliberate changes. These experiments must be preregistered when possible to prevent data dredging and to maintain credibility. By demonstrating consistent behavior across varied scenarios, teams establish that detected causal relationships reflect genuine mechanisms rather than coincidental patterns in a single dataset.
The synthesis of causal attribution methods rests on disciplined methodology and ongoing scrutiny. Practitioners should articulate a clear causal question, adopt a layered suite of diagnostics, and seek convergent evidence from multiple approaches. This multi-pronged stance helps uncover spurious correlations hiding in training sets and supports robust model behavior under distributional shifts. Ultimately, the goal is to build predictive systems that respond to real-world causes and resist shortcutting by irrelevant or biased data. A culture of transparency and rigorous testing makes causal explanations accessible to stakeholders and users alike.
Beyond technical rigor, causal attribution connects to governance, ethics, and user trust. By consistently distinguishing genuine determinants from confounding factors, teams reduce the risk of biased decisions, unfair outcomes, and fragile performance. The practical takeaway is to embed causal thinking into every stage of development, from data collection to model monitoring and post-deployment evaluation. When organizations embrace this mindset, they create models that not only perform, but also explain and endure across changing circumstances. The enduring benefit is clearer insight, safer deployment, and more responsible use of AI.
Related Articles
NLP
This evergreen guide explores practical, evidence-based methods to reduce annotation bias arising from uneven labeling guidelines and diverse annotator backgrounds, offering scalable strategies for fairer natural language processing models and more reliable data annotation workflows.
-
July 29, 2025
NLP
This evergreen guide outlines practical methods for detecting drift, evaluating NLP model health, and sustaining reliable production performance through disciplined monitoring, governance, and proactive remediation across varied deployment contexts.
-
August 09, 2025
NLP
This evergreen guide outlines practical, rigorous evaluation frameworks to assess how language models may reproduce harmful stereotypes, offering actionable measurement strategies, ethical guardrails, and iterative improvement paths for responsible AI deployment.
-
July 19, 2025
NLP
This evergreen guide surveys methods to uncover interlinked entities and layered relationships within intricate sentences, detailing practical strategies, robust modeling choices, and evaluation approaches that stay effective as language usage evolves.
-
July 21, 2025
NLP
This evergreen guide explores robust strategies for designing cross-lingual retrieval systems that honor linguistic diversity, preserve nuance, and deliver accurate results across languages in real-world information ecosystems.
-
July 16, 2025
NLP
A practical exploration of integrating retrieval, ranking, and summarization to power conversational search that understands user intent, retrieves relevant sources, and crafts concise, accurate responses in dynamic, real‑world contexts.
-
July 28, 2025
NLP
A practical guide explores how to design end-to-end workflows that generate clear, consistent model cards, empowering teams to disclose capabilities, weaknesses, and potential hazards with confidence and accountability.
-
August 06, 2025
NLP
A practical guide to designing, cleaning, annotating, and validating large NLP datasets so supervised models learn robust language patterns, reduce bias, and scale responsibly across diverse domains and languages.
-
July 15, 2025
NLP
A practical exploration of how researchers combine textual patterns, network ties, and context signals to detect misinformation networks, emphasizing resilience, scalability, and interpretability for real-world deployment.
-
July 15, 2025
NLP
Harnessing layered representations unlocks nuanced understanding by combining fine-grained textual cues with overarching structure, enabling robust semantic extraction, improved retrieval, and adaptable analysis across diverse document domains and languages.
-
August 03, 2025
NLP
This article explores practical approaches to automatically identify risk factors and actionable recommendations within clinical trial reports, combining natural language processing, ontology-driven reasoning, and robust validation to support evidence-based decision making.
-
July 24, 2025
NLP
This evergreen guide investigates how researchers and practitioners quantify underperformance linked to minority dialects and sociolects, why biases emerge, and which rigorous strategies foster fairer, more accurate language technology systems over time.
-
July 17, 2025
NLP
As language evolves across platforms, robust normalization becomes foundational for understanding slang, emojis, and script diversity, enabling reliable interpretation, sentiment detection, and multilingual processing in real-world NLP pipelines.
-
July 23, 2025
NLP
This article outlines durable, end-to-end pipelines for analyzing legal documents, focusing on identifying obligations, risk factors, and liability, while preserving accuracy, transparency, and adaptability across jurisdictions.
-
August 08, 2025
NLP
Crafting resilient, context-aware anonymization methods guards privacy, yet preserves essential semantic and statistical utility for future analytics, benchmarking, and responsible data science across varied text datasets and domains.
-
July 16, 2025
NLP
Multilingual fine-tuning thrives on careful data selection, elastic forgetting controls, and principled evaluation across languages, ensuring robust performance even when labeled examples are scarce and languages diverge in structure, script, and domain.
-
July 22, 2025
NLP
This evergreen guide examines how grounding neural outputs in verified knowledge sources can curb hallucinations, outlining practical strategies, challenges, and future directions for building more reliable, trustworthy language models.
-
August 11, 2025
NLP
As multilingual digital assistants expand across markets, robust cross-lingual intent mapping becomes essential, harmonizing user expressions, regional semantics, and language-specific pragmatics to deliver accurate, context-aware interactions across diverse languages.
-
August 11, 2025
NLP
A practical, evergreen guide detailing strategic approaches, data processes, and indexing architectures that empower investigators and researchers to connect people, events, and concepts across diverse sources with precision and efficiency.
-
July 25, 2025
NLP
A practical guide to recognizing dialectal variations, mapping them to suitable processing pipelines, and ensuring resilient, scalable NLP deployments across diverse language communities.
-
July 23, 2025